Episode 9: "Why Don't You Love Me"


Listen Later

Episode nine finds Beyoncé at home in 1957, ironing, scrubbing, washing dishes in bright blue rubber gloves, and drinking so many martinis that we see our Stepford wife glitching and, finally, breaking. "Why Don't You Love Me" is as much Beyoncé's take on her relationship to culture as on 50 years of American matrimony. Our analysis takes you from Los Angeles to Rio de Janeiro, with special help from Betty Friedan, Mr. Clean, Solange, Nina Simone, James Brown, and, naturally, B.B. Homemaker herself.
